From patchwork Thu May 6 05:11:21 2021 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Andreas Rheinhardt X-Patchwork-Id: 27607 Delivered-To: ffmpegpatchwork2@gmail.com Received: by 2002:a6b:6109:0:0:0:0:0 with SMTP id v9csp987952iob; Wed, 5 May 2021 22:28:13 -0700 (PDT) X-Google-Smtp-Source: ABdhPJwKHFkgwFzlrXKv7Kfxn4ZuXURYw3V7qpwhrgzJnzZbhhXI2Sa+k2RoeMFH+U8mexdqZlFJ X-Received: by 2002:a17:906:b850:: with SMTP id ga16mr2405391ejb.161.1620278893450; Wed, 05 May 2021 22:28:13 -0700 (PDT)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org. [79.124.17.100]) by mx.google.com with ESMTP id eb8si1412684edb.49.2021.05.05.22.28.12; Wed, 05 May 2021 22:28:13 -0700 (PDT) Received-SPF: p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) client-ip=79.124.17.100;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@outlook.com header.s=selector1 header.b=c+ZVkISf; arc=fail (body hash mismatch); sp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=outlook.com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id A179168089B; Thu, 6 May 2021 08:28:09 +0300 (EEST) X-Original-To: ffmpeg-devel@ffmpeg.org Delivered-To: ffmpeg-devel@ffmpeg.org Received: from EUR04-VI1-obe.outbound.protection.outlook.com (mail-oln040092075028.outbound.protection.outlook.com [40.92.75.28]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id CDC37680529 for ; Thu, 6 May 2021 08:28:02 +0300 (EE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=F6GOvk5nIL18DqO/YCqlR7PZ5mluURwzK7NivcHjQ3MSGUkjFPCmHR2VEAJjpac0gSnrWL5TE9RBHVQgBqoOQ4uSLgZh35DA9Smn3nRYvJTNm/ZXEI0unzoS5MiCeowMqkTIwcT0sR66g2G8eMPLZv+drD6j/tpBdrym4PmyTUr4+2enVpJeeen9m9V2X/VscHy61PIp7yZEuw7GJn+w+pTzuRShlMteBdpyYONVzPR5sVjTaJAbr5c8HNDr2pBxBGMY6qZuOMW+pJrh/PU3jp/0SOD7ORCOy5DiyPX8pH2X2Nlry+if1w1pyq7m3Bc6AaeseODtkv0ZG/5gti9g2g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=HqQ7tolHVJJF7JOiyB0sFVCdkq7NYkcTOTycHDCv2nY=; b=YPuzzn43FlrJyRJ596dryTFx4lBZgIutQz+mWeQKNL6U0WsrtnOeKMtkjMDjsQSgTW03H7rM0OsEHdQKnrgwoJRS0rJyfUS8WsFGTSLeaa4Tt/SuAvkHrNC6j0GUCB/qi/3bOnWrc5TnOJoxa+jHABKEShrPFlR3ZOVFD4QuE8rYngcMVwfcqfgTqSLcWN7PhEfGp2PFr3YdEoGsSTmnt/6liJGaCCGilhZ7hkRY418LTs6AkH5kSdhxslZ/KTXaXgGoqjt9WUUqoGh+taIRz8lU689tA/a3xwKYaQxpUV4idyJnOSk+NDFAXZXG+IBqwpIdLYkkq2vE430DN1v/yQ==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=outlook.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=HqQ7tolHVJJF7JOiyB0sFVCdkq7NYkcTOTycHDCv2nY=; b=c+ZVkISfY/Ehr/zmJZ07nngGj2gbkOAcL76cNOfkb/a0anCBDwid+3/cXD9TlDuVk2ciPX7bGaIuHRcunP1WwFsE5RezDuBBsii8/6CeOq5FJ/292fB048tlAqZqco83IW/m4Jpj68TSPcIsXmWAy7TCdurzbWVFXq9x6DD6jbNtMOy/+uoK+3gkFfYQ0S9sBJjNqHG3EhP9RExo4ndvZhCVSyMsxS0ir9s1kAlPCTa6tgm/WeuElqlu+5pefH93XA145IuWqGX7zO4poh74ZhKsAj7OCkLwbrACaT41sDZRa0Y59NlUTav+iFOeXcG0feLtlD7/eKT4q7IFvp4Htw== Received: from DB3EUR04FT015.eop-eur04.prod.protection.outlook.com (2a01:111:e400:7e0c::41) by DB3EUR04HT047.eop-eur04.prod.protection.outlook.com (2a01:111:e400:7e0c::321)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4108.25; Thu, 6 May 2021 05:12:07 +0000 Received: from VI1PR0301MB2159.eurprd03.prod.outlook.com (2a01:111:e400:7e0c::40) by DB3EUR04FT015.mail.protection.outlook.com (2a01:111:e400:7e0c::453)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4108.25 via Frontend Transport; Thu, 6 May 2021 05:12:07 +0000 X-IncomingTopHeaderMarker: OriginalChecksum:B4037C9C6480F81AE3596E6AD810BF9D0ABD738C311EE0432C24A3A2E1C07C32; UpperCasedChecksum:54CB78F05E2F3EB4698236202C11B50A5ED884247B0E204F9231FCD660D85EA4; SizeAsReceived:7605; Count:48 Received: from VI1PR0301MB2159.eurprd03.prod.outlook.com ([fe80::d9b:66ba:63ad:967b]) by VI1PR0301MB2159.eurprd03.prod.outlook.com ([fe80::d9b:66ba:63ad:967b%5]) with mapi id 15.20.4108.026; Thu, 6 May 2021 05:12:07 +0000 From: Andreas Rheinhardt To: ffmpeg-devel@ffmpeg.org Date: Thu, 6 May 2021 07:11:21 +0200 Message-ID: X-Mailer: git-send-email 2.27.0 In-Reply-To: References: X-TMN: [97Rhz4IqgtIXjFldvY6qQVAiZ97mSh/WHfQ25LVeg5c=] X-ClientProxiedBy: ZR0P278CA0145.CHEP278.PROD.OUTLOOK.COM (2603:10a6:910:41::15) To VI1PR0301MB2159.eurprd03.prod.outlook.com (2603:10a6:800:26::20) X-Microsoft-Original-Message-ID: <20210506051121.832886-22-andreas.rheinhardt@outlook.com> M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 Received: from sblaptop.fritz.box (188.193.170.150) by ZR0P278CA0145.CHEP278.PROD.OUTLOOK.COM (2603:10a6:910:41::15)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4108.24 via Frontend Transport; Thu, 6 May 2021 05:12:06 +0000 X-MS-PublicTrafficType: Email X-IncomingHeaderCount: 48 X-EOPAttributedMessage: 0 X-MS-Office365-Filtering-Correlation-Id: b5e06d7e-5494-4ff4-2403-08d9104d7e33 X-MS-Exchange-SLBlob-MailProps: gjx25WM8ZNX1vi4Zzd+e+UNdoYIlAK0S/ll7i9GaYTFASg7m7W7iC/RBHta62MrC9EA84PqfooFteqPrscK+FHAiMioGQpsMEhVq9GGnkgNHWxIfjvk2oVaMfqjgHwbwZ068p0i3lhF0skfzdXLN1Hzf+q/nSZwxfGFDHadOcdQ9wNO3gd6xjmqLSEuKA1HhxOkTdkq0ihMOh2jFreeQTA4Dv/nqXd0ren8u/mTlymayoENM1s0+64YGXuDcLO7qOnd5yCKHVRE2xNs+FDlmKPGpX3TTsN9KRPYOfPLEmHHfjdIpykOUZpKmkL+B4MrU9cu07SuDkI5k7JRPoPCj9EgehrdGzJdHWuLE9WZv1e9v0tYdVnJEHjeJ6eeR/Wp+XKVkDFGwKsxmfXDVj60pw4hvCZS5mhjSkOLuHpcO75N5emhytAPNDnjAnl81BxkXzTxmmnSo1q2YEYSsDBZ80J0reADfoetD+wgLi0tpB7M1bbdz+6j7pCdk5WY9HHTV1q5CKkgt3YhLa9IA+YzoQafW1DYWwTUgyxhxAeV5XnYm5b35D6r2itlug7sahm8Jb+EHZc5ITYwI6lMcDuXkHFPnlVfN/BTXOo4Gl6DGxLgNtZMAVg3FDTQOAUyv/EEguQqAxdeykyP+a8UIdozAkul8s26qU6YKfcUf3zSav/C17GiGl54HAtk9ls7QsBIAhY0LmOq6ukqnwFNnGcodRAZ4JMJp/wcYFAPtzIM6yms= X-MS-TrafficTypeDiagnostic: DB3EUR04HT047: X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: aUJbbACyW528QYTheIGvO9JCguTYPVISP4o59sOuW/i8UgE16MmDm3KeEbVwpzOZ/pA3p6JCKaGZbArtJInL5VjIMqSCSfbWynTtNkCMtFMvdg723xvLn72Q5D7Okjgv+SyDJEsZeBhlb6FWoI8FiOeSVvIMq3ylmbUGgu6CfUMzxtP0HwXmMEm8cgd+65btoQXHF2vsKr/f8C2pfIj7J19dF7Dgxjgg9f5nHcvanTwgerY2F3QgKo37G1ob76sYgk/3DkS5s02lBwxYEkyd48xK2g5YUMGq3HqKpbOECJ4ILQAcitmcbbrKRhylxwXifkmQWNgSdof7BIpp0StWcoh5fEuNf2H4dcsg4jvvfaEDzWsrZD9DqlZ0pd8niabNJrJpP3re/xJhFbqiHVIusQ== X-MS-Exchange-AntiSpam-MessageData: 69BtPt+tfLr1XYx6I7h6SJ8q2otizR+eGY+rXdFzGB41cycJQr+ayk2RlieoBUhFLyTnKjgH/fO+T5cITxqyJBSAyRMZ8hORC4Ksx6eT5f6oFfSG6RfANf4krVkW2NeAcmfcV1fT/f50n7NZaeM7hQ== X-OriginatorOrg: out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: b5e06d7e-5494-4ff4-2403-08d9104d7e33 X-MS-Exchange-CrossTenant-OriginalArrivalTime: 06 May 2021 05:12:06.7711 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-AuthSource: DB3EUR04FT015.eop-eur04.prod.protection.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Anonymous X-MS-Exchange-CrossTenant-FromEntityHeader: Internet X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: DB3EUR04HT047 Subject: [FFmpeg-devel] [PATCH 23/23] avcodec/dnxhdenc: Mark encoder as init-threadsafe X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Cc: Andreas Rheinhardt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" X-TUID: FBndDiVkHSKE Signed-off-by: Andreas Rheinhardt --- libavcodec/dnxhdenc.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libavcodec/dnxhdenc.c b/libavcodec/dnxhdenc.c index 1a59815472..ee45c64ff4 100644 --- a/libavcodec/dnxhdenc.c +++ b/libavcodec/dnxhdenc.c @@ -1360,7 +1360,6 @@ const AVCodec ff_dnxhd_encoder = { .init = dnxhd_encode_init, .encode2 = dnxhd_encode_picture, .close = dnxhd_encode_end, - .caps_internal = FF_CODEC_CAP_INIT_CLEANUP, .pix_fmts = (const enum AVPixelFormat[]) { AV_PIX_FMT_YUV422P, AV_PIX_FMT_YUV422P10, @@ -1371,4 +1370,5 @@ const AVCodec ff_dnxhd_encoder = { .priv_class = &dnxhd_class, .defaults = dnxhd_defaults, .profiles = NULL_IF_CONFIG_SMALL(ff_dnxhd_profiles), + .caps_internal = FF_CODEC_CAP_INIT_THREADSAFE | FF_CODEC_CAP_INIT_CLEANUP, };